DECISION, ORDER & JUDGMENT

Writ of habeas corpus in the nature of an application to release Russell DeFreitas upon his own recognizance or to set reasonable bail pursuant to CPL 30.30(2)(a) upon Suffolk County Indictment No. 71385/2023, and application for poor person relief.

ORDERED that the application for poor person relief is granted to the extent that the filing fee imposed by CPLR 8022(b) is waived, and the application is otherwise denied as academic; and it is further,

ADJUDGED that the writ is dismissed, without costs or disbursements.

The petitioner failed to demonstrate entitlement to relief pursuant to CPL 30.30(2)(a).

CONNOLLY, J.P., GENOVESI, WARHIT and TAYLOR, JJ., concur.
